Output 65fac5a69cc605535153f4318e3ec3336fb963d0ebede1882b4deaf1b5e8b7af:1

value
14639
script pubkey
OP_0 OP_PUSHBYTES_20 51b5d10200504270a61c0501c932f2cecc7c5e8a
address
bc1q2x6azqsq2pp8pfsuq5qujvhjemx8ch524lsqr0
transaction
65fac5a69cc605535153f4318e3ec3336fb963d0ebede1882b4deaf1b5e8b7af
spent
true